Changeset 8dcf31e in prototipo_portal_2018


Ignore:
Timestamp:
Nov 6, 2017, 10:57:35 AM (6 years ago)
Author:
José Sulbarán <jsulbaran@…>
Branches:
master
Children:
68a964b
Parents:
c1f6510 (diff), 75b1cd5 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the (diff) links above to see all the changes relative to each parent.
Message:

Merge branch 'master' of https://tibisay.cenditel.gob.ve/murachi/scm/git/portal

Location:
prototipo
Files:
1 added
2 edited

Legend:

Unmodified
Added
Removed
  • prototipo/index.html

    r5de7549 rc1f6510  
    156156                              <li><a href="#" id="firm_no_v" class="list-group-item list-group-item-link" data-toggle="collapse" data-target="#Formato_Normal">Firma No visible <span class="glyphicon glyphicon-chevron-down"></span></a>
    157157                                <ul class="nav collapse" id="Formato_Normal" role="menu" aria-labelledby="btn-1">
     158                                  <form id ="Form-Format-No-Visible"  enctype='multipart/form-data'>
    158159                                    <div class="btn-group" id="Formato_Normal">
    159160                                       <button type="button" id="upload-Normal" class="btn btn-success btn-sm">
    160161                                          <span class="glyphicon glyphicon-folder-open"></span> Cargar
    161162                                       </button>
    162                                        <button type="button" id="firmar-doc-noVisible"  class="btn btn-info btn-sm buttons-plantilla">
     163                                       <button type="submit" id="firmar-doc-noVisible"  class="btn btn-info btn-sm buttons-plantilla">
    163164                                          <span class="glyphicon glyphicon-ok"></span> Firmar
    164165                                       </button>
    165166                                        <input type="file" id="file-to-normal" accept="application/pdf" />
    166167                                    </div>
     168                                  </form>
    167169                                </ul>                           
    168170                              </li>                   
     
    173175                    </li>                   
    174176                  </div>
    175                 </ul>
    176                
     177                </ul>               
    177178            </li> 
    178179
     180
     181
     182
     183
     184            <li><a href="#" id="btn-1" class="list-group-item list-group-item-success" data-toggle="collapse" data-target="#VerifiSing" >Verificar Sign <span class="glyphicon glyphicon-chevron-down"></span></a>     
     185                <ul class="nav collapse" id="VerifiSing" role="menu" aria-labelledby="btn-1">
     186                  <div class="col-md-12 col-width " id="VerifiSing">
     187                    <li><a href="#" id="btn-2" class="list-group-item list-group-item-info" data-toggle="collapse" data-target="#pdf" >Formato PDF <span class="glyphicon glyphicon-chevron-down"></span></a>
     188                    </li>
     189                        <ul class="nav collapse" id="pdf" role="menu" aria-labelledby="btn-1">
     190                          <div class="col-sm-12 col-width" id="ppdf">
     191                            <li><a href="#" id="firm_v" class="list-group-item list-group-item-link" data-toggle="collapse" data-target="#Formato_Visible" >Firma Visible <span class="glyphicon glyphicon-chevron-down"></span></a>
     192                            </li>
     193                             <ul class="nav collapse" id="Formato_Visible" role="menu" aria-labelledby="btn-1">
     194                                <form id ="Form-Format-Visible"  enctype='multipart/form-data' >
     195                                  <div class="btn-group" id="Formato_Visible">
     196                                     <button type="button" id="upload-button2" class="btn btn-success btn-sm">
     197                                        <span class="glyphicon glyphicon-folder-open"></span> Cargar
     198                                     </button>
     199                                     <button type="submit" id="firmar-documento"  class="btn btn-info btn-sm buttons-plantilla">
     200                                        <span class="glyphicon glyphicon-ok"></span> Firmar
     201                                     </button>
     202                                     <input type="hidden" class="form-control" id="dataX" placeholder="x">
     203                                     <input type="hidden" class="form-control" id="dataY" placeholder="y">
     204                                     <input type="hidden" class="form-control" id="pagepdf" placeholder="Page of pdf">
     205                                     <input type="file" id="file-sign-ft_Vble" accept="application/pdf" />
     206                                  </div>
     207                                </form>
     208                                <div class="text imagen" id="texto"></div>
     209                              </ul>                           
     210                              <li><a href="#" id="firm_no_v" class="list-group-item list-group-item-link" data-toggle="collapse" data-target="#Formato_Normal">Firma No visible <span class="glyphicon glyphicon-chevron-down"></span></a>
     211                                <ul class="nav collapse" id="Formato_Normal" role="menu" aria-labelledby="btn-1">
     212                                  <form id ="Form-Format-No-Visible"  enctype='multipart/form-data'>
     213                                    <div class="btn-group" id="Formato_Normal">
     214                                       <button type="button" id="upload-Normal" class="btn btn-success btn-sm">
     215                                          <span class="glyphicon glyphicon-folder-open"></span> Cargar
     216                                       </button>
     217                                       <button type="submit" id="firmar-doc-noVisible"  class="btn btn-info btn-sm buttons-plantilla">
     218                                          <span class="glyphicon glyphicon-ok"></span> Firmar
     219                                       </button>
     220                                        <input type="file" id="file-to-normal" accept="application/pdf" />
     221                                    </div>
     222                                  </form>
     223                                </ul>                           
     224                              </li>                   
     225                          </div>
     226                        </ul>
     227                 
     228                  </div>
     229                </ul>               
     230            </li>
     231
     232
     233
     234
     235
    179236           
    180             <li><a href="#" id="btn-1" class="list-group-item list-group-item-success" data-toggle="collapse" data-target="#submenu2" >Verificar</a>
     237            <li><a href="#" id="btn-1" class="list-group-item list-group-item-success" data-toggle="collapse" data-target="#submenu2" >Verificar Sign</a>
    181238                <ul class="nav collapse" id="submenu2" role="menu" aria-labelledby="btn-1">
    182239                    <div class="col-sm-4" id="submenu2">
     
    240297     
    241298        <div class="well cuerpo" >
    242           <div id="pdf-main-container"><center>Firma Visible</center>
     299          <div id="pdf-main-container"><center><h2>Firma Visible</h2></center>
    243300            <div id="pdf-loader2">Cargando documento ...</div>
    244301            <div id="pdf-contents2">
     
    265322              <div id="page-loader2">Cargando página ...</div>
    266323            </div>
    267             <div id="pdf-main-container2"><center>Firma Normal</center>
     324            <div id="pdf-main-container2"><center><h2>Firma No Visible<h2></center>
    268325              <div id="pdf-loader3">Cargando documento ...</div>
    269326              <div id="pdf-contents3">
     
    284341                  </div>
    285342                </div>
    286                 </div>
    287                 <canvas id="pdf-canvas3" width="500"></canvas>
    288                 <div id="page-loader3">Cargando página ...</div>
    289343              </div>
     344              <canvas id="pdf-canvas3" width="500"></canvas>
     345              <div id="page-loader3">Cargando página ...</div>
     346            </div>
    290347          </div>
    291348          <!-- MyData table -->
    292           <div class=" ">
     349          <div>
    293350            <table id="myJson" class="display" cellspacing="0" width="100%">           
    294351            </table> 
     
    343400  <script src="static/js/functions/DraggableSortable.js"></script>
    344401  <script src="static/js/docsDraggable.js"></script>
    345   <!-- sign PDF -->
     402  <!-- sign visisble PDF -->
    346403  <script src="static/js/functions/manejoJsonPDF.js"></script>
    347404  <script src="static/js/functions/signFunctions.js"></script>
    348405  <script src="static/js/functions/PDF/myInfoDataTablePDF.js"></script>
    349406  <script src="static/js/functions/firmarDocumentoPdf.js"></script>
     407  <!-- sign no visisble PDF  -->
     408  <script src="static/js/functions/firmarDocumentoPdfNoVisible.js"></script>
     409  <!-- Verificar sign PDF-->
     410  <script src="static/js/functions/VerificarSign.js"></script>
    350411
    351412
  • prototipo/static/js/functions/firmarDocumentoPdf.js

    rc1f6510 r8dcf31e  
    5252                url:"https://murachi.cenditel.gob.ve/Murachi/0.1/archivos/pdfs/resenas",
    5353                dataType: 'json',
    54                 data: JSON.stringify({"signature":signature.hex}),
     54                data: JSON.stringify({"signature":signature}),
    5555                xhrFields: {withCredentials: true},
    5656                headers: {"Authorization":"Basic YWRtaW46YWRtaW4="},
     
    7575
    7676//Tercer paso (Obtenemos el hash de pdf enviado por el servidor y luego procesa la información en el token)
    77 function ObtenerHashPDFServer(parameters){
     77function ObtenerHashPDFServer(parameters,cert){
    7878
    7979        $.ajax({
     
    155155
    156156                        // ahora llamar al ajax de obtener la resena del pdf
    157                         ObtenerHashPDFServer(parameters);       
     157                        ObtenerHashPDFServer(parameters, cert);
    158158
    159159                },
Note: See TracChangeset for help on using the changeset viewer.